The Cribs are at number one this week on the UK Record Store Chart, with Rat Boy’s debut Scum new at #3.
Another high new entry comes from Everything Everything and their latest album A Fever Dream, while Royal Blood remain in the Top 20.
Since 2012, the UK Record Store Chart has been charting the best selling albums sold at 100 of Britain’s leading independent music shops.
